Palace built for Prince John George, by the architect F.W. Erdmannsdorff. The construction is located in Dessau, Germany. Germany Dessau. Building Eighteenth Century, Renaissance-Baroque styles and periods, Europe, First and Second Millennium A.D.. Date of Photograph:1890-1910 ca.. Date of Artwork:1780 ca.. Artist:Von Erdmannsdorff, W

This print transports us back in time to the grandeur of Prince John George's palace, located in Dessau, Germany. Built by the esteemed architect F. W. Erdmannsdorff, this architectural masterpiece stands as a testament to the opulence and elegance of its era. The photograph captures the exterior of the palace, showcasing its intricate design and attention to detail. A majestic street lamp illuminates the scene, casting a soft glow on the urban surroundings. The gate fence, made of wrought metal, adds an air of sophistication while also providing security for this regal abode.
